bekomme icecast server nicht ans laufen
bekomme icecast server nicht ans laufen
Hallo Forum,
ich würde in unserem Hausnetzwerk gerne den Icecast-Server installieren. Ich verwende Debian woody und habe die enthaltene Version (1.3..1.4.2) installiert.
Ich kann den Icecast Server zwar starten, bekomme allerdings über Winamp keine Verbindung.
Gehe ich auf die Seite
http://192.168.100.1:8000/list.cgi
wird mir angezeigt, dass icecast als HTTP server oder so läuft und eben keine Sourcen verbunden sind.
Im Winamp habe ich alle Zugangsdaten richtig eingetragen.
Für eure Hilfe bedanke ich mich im Voraus
Hier meine icecast.conf:
touch_freq 5
max_clients 10
logfile icecast.log
server_name debian
console_mode 3
statshtml_log /var/www/icecast.htm
stats_time 5
rp_email tsibi@gmx.de
accessfile access.log
usagefile usage.log
port 8000
encoder_password geheim
ich würde in unserem Hausnetzwerk gerne den Icecast-Server installieren. Ich verwende Debian woody und habe die enthaltene Version (1.3..1.4.2) installiert.
Ich kann den Icecast Server zwar starten, bekomme allerdings über Winamp keine Verbindung.
Gehe ich auf die Seite
http://192.168.100.1:8000/list.cgi
wird mir angezeigt, dass icecast als HTTP server oder so läuft und eben keine Sourcen verbunden sind.
Im Winamp habe ich alle Zugangsdaten richtig eingetragen.
Für eure Hilfe bedanke ich mich im Voraus
Hier meine icecast.conf:
touch_freq 5
max_clients 10
logfile icecast.log
server_name debian
console_mode 3
statshtml_log /var/www/icecast.htm
stats_time 5
rp_email tsibi@gmx.de
accessfile access.log
usagefile usage.log
port 8000
encoder_password geheim
Hallo,
auf dem Laptop von Winamp ist keine Firewall installiert. Klicke ich in Winamp auf connect versucht er zwar eine
Verbindung herzustellen, springt dann kurz auf disconnect und dann eben wieder auf connect. In den logfiles von icecast taucht da aber gar nichts auf.
Stattdessen hab ichs mal mit liveice versucht. Hier habe ich das richtige Passwort in die Config-Datei eingetragen,
doch die Verbindung klappt nicht.
Hier ein Auszug aus der icecast.log:
[01/Sep/2004:13:53:10] [0:Main Thread] Icecast Version 1.3.11-debian Starting..
[01/Sep/2004:13:53:10] [0:Main Thread] Trying to fork
[01/Sep/2004:13:53:10] [0:Main Thread] Detached (pid: 1187)
[01/Sep/2004:13:53:10] [0:Main Thread] Starting main connection handler...
[01/Sep/2004:13:53:10] [0:Main Thread] Listening on port 8000...
[01/Sep/2004:13:53:10] [0:Main Thread] Using 'debian' as servername...
[01/Sep/2004:13:53:10] [0:Main Thread] Server limits: 10 clients, 800 clients per source, 5 sources, 5 admins
[01/Sep/2004:13:53:10] [0:Main Thread] WWW Admin interface accessible at http://debian:8000/admin
[01/Sep/2004:13:53:10] [0:Main Thread] Starting Calender Thread...
[01/Sep/2004:13:53:10] [0:Main Thread] Starting UDP handler thread...
[01/Sep/2004:13:53:10] [0:Main Thread] Starting relay connector thread...
[01/Sep/2004:13:55:52] [4:Connection Handler] Kicking source 0 [localhost] [Bad Password] [encoder], connected for 0 seconds, 0 bytes transfered. -1 sources connected
[01/Sep/2004:13:55:52] [4:Connection Handler] Kicking all 0 clients for source 0
Danke im Voraus
tsibi
auf dem Laptop von Winamp ist keine Firewall installiert. Klicke ich in Winamp auf connect versucht er zwar eine
Verbindung herzustellen, springt dann kurz auf disconnect und dann eben wieder auf connect. In den logfiles von icecast taucht da aber gar nichts auf.
Stattdessen hab ichs mal mit liveice versucht. Hier habe ich das richtige Passwort in die Config-Datei eingetragen,
doch die Verbindung klappt nicht.
Hier ein Auszug aus der icecast.log:
[01/Sep/2004:13:53:10] [0:Main Thread] Icecast Version 1.3.11-debian Starting..
[01/Sep/2004:13:53:10] [0:Main Thread] Trying to fork
[01/Sep/2004:13:53:10] [0:Main Thread] Detached (pid: 1187)
[01/Sep/2004:13:53:10] [0:Main Thread] Starting main connection handler...
[01/Sep/2004:13:53:10] [0:Main Thread] Listening on port 8000...
[01/Sep/2004:13:53:10] [0:Main Thread] Using 'debian' as servername...
[01/Sep/2004:13:53:10] [0:Main Thread] Server limits: 10 clients, 800 clients per source, 5 sources, 5 admins
[01/Sep/2004:13:53:10] [0:Main Thread] WWW Admin interface accessible at http://debian:8000/admin
[01/Sep/2004:13:53:10] [0:Main Thread] Starting Calender Thread...
[01/Sep/2004:13:53:10] [0:Main Thread] Starting UDP handler thread...
[01/Sep/2004:13:53:10] [0:Main Thread] Starting relay connector thread...
[01/Sep/2004:13:55:52] [4:Connection Handler] Kicking source 0 [localhost] [Bad Password] [encoder], connected for 0 seconds, 0 bytes transfered. -1 sources connected
[01/Sep/2004:13:55:52] [4:Connection Handler] Kicking all 0 clients for source 0
Danke im Voraus
tsibi
- Payne_of_Death
- Beiträge: 484
- Registriert: 16.05.2004 20:21:30
-
Kontaktdaten:
Mir sagt dieser Server allgemein nichts.
Vielleicht hilft es mal zu erklären was dieser überhaupt tut.
[Vermutung]
Ich vermute mal das es sich um einen Internet Radio Server handelt oder?
Und dieser wird vermutlich aus dem Internet Sourcen laden.
Dann wäre die Frage offen ob der Router 8000 an den richtigen Rechner routet und überhaupt durchlässt
[/Vermutung]
Vielleicht hilft es mal zu erklären was dieser überhaupt tut.
[Vermutung]
Ich vermute mal das es sich um einen Internet Radio Server handelt oder?
Und dieser wird vermutlich aus dem Internet Sourcen laden.
Dann wäre die Frage offen ob der Router 8000 an den richtigen Rechner routet und überhaupt durchlässt
[/Vermutung]
Das System was mich zu Fall bringt muss erst mal geboren werden.
hi,
schau dir das mal an: http://home.arcor.de/patrick.z/streaming.pdf.
Bei mir läuft der Server super und ich hab auch keine Probleme beim verbinden.
Nur was ich bei dir nicht verstehe ist http://192.168.100.1:8000/list.cgi .
Wofür brauchst du list.cgi?
Also wenn ich einen audio-stream abfangen möchte, öffne ich immer xmms und füge
dann die url 192.168.100.1:8000 ein.
schau dir das mal an: http://home.arcor.de/patrick.z/streaming.pdf.
Bei mir läuft der Server super und ich hab auch keine Probleme beim verbinden.
Nur was ich bei dir nicht verstehe ist http://192.168.100.1:8000/list.cgi .
Wofür brauchst du list.cgi?
Also wenn ich einen audio-stream abfangen möchte, öffne ich immer xmms und füge
dann die url 192.168.100.1:8000 ein.
Hallo,
ich glaube nicht, dass Probleme mit dem Tastatur-Layout vorliegen. Ich habe ja immer nur das Passwort geheim eingetragen:
encoder_password geheim
admin_password geheim
oper_password geheim
Und hier meine liveice.cfg:
SERVER localhost
PORT 8000
PASSWORD geheim
SHOUT_MODE
NO_SOUNDCARD
PLAYLIST /root/playlist.txt
Schöne Grüße und Danke für weitere Hilfe
tsibi
ich glaube nicht, dass Probleme mit dem Tastatur-Layout vorliegen. Ich habe ja immer nur das Passwort geheim eingetragen:
encoder_password geheim
admin_password geheim
oper_password geheim
Und hier meine liveice.cfg:
SERVER localhost
PORT 8000
PASSWORD geheim
SHOUT_MODE
NO_SOUNDCARD
PLAYLIST /root/playlist.txt
Schöne Grüße und Danke für weitere Hilfe
tsibi
- mragucci
- Beiträge: 598
- Registriert: 08.09.2004 03:21:24
- Lizenz eigener Beiträge: MIT Lizenz
- Wohnort: Endor
-
Kontaktdaten:
icecast-server
Servus!
*räusper*
cya,
Mario
*räusper*
In meiner icecast.conf:Note about Icecast passwords
Icecast has been compiled with encrypted passwords support. Plain text
password consequently won't work. Please read the README.Debian file to
learn how to generate encrypted passwords
Hoffe Dir geholfen zu haben!######################### Server passwords #####################################
# icecast for Debian has been compiled with crypt support.
# Thus, you have to create a crypted version of the password.
# You can generate encrypted passwords with makepasswd.
# Please *change* default password before using it.
#########################
cya,
Mario
Re: icecast-server
Hallo,
danke für deine Antwort. Du hast gerade mein Brett vorm Kopf weggeschlagen. So was ist echt peinlich.
Jetzt klappt das connecten mit Winamp. Ich möchte aber auch noch mittels liveice eine Playlist laufen lassen. Meine Config-File siehst du in einem vorherigen Beitrag.
Für Hilfe wäre ich sehr dankbar.
Ich habe in die liveice-config das unverschlüsselte Passwort eingetragen.
Gruß
Simon
danke für deine Antwort. Du hast gerade mein Brett vorm Kopf weggeschlagen. So was ist echt peinlich.
Jetzt klappt das connecten mit Winamp. Ich möchte aber auch noch mittels liveice eine Playlist laufen lassen. Meine Config-File siehst du in einem vorherigen Beitrag.
Für Hilfe wäre ich sehr dankbar.
Ich habe in die liveice-config das unverschlüsselte Passwort eingetragen.
Gruß
Simon
- mragucci
- Beiträge: 598
- Registriert: 08.09.2004 03:21:24
- Lizenz eigener Beiträge: MIT Lizenz
- Wohnort: Endor
-
Kontaktdaten:
icecast und icelive
Sers,
freut mich, Schritt 1 hätten wir ja dann schon mal
Welcher Fehler taucht denn bei liveice auf, bzw. was steht im icecast-log?
Vergiss nicht, dass in der liveice.cfg 2x nach einem passwort gefragt wird, einmal ganz oben und einmal ziemlich in der Mitte....
cya,
Mario
freut mich, Schritt 1 hätten wir ja dann schon mal
Welcher Fehler taucht denn bei liveice auf, bzw. was steht im icecast-log?
Vergiss nicht, dass in der liveice.cfg 2x nach einem passwort gefragt wird, einmal ganz oben und einmal ziemlich in der Mitte....
cya,
Mario
Re: icecast und icelive
Hallo,
freut mich, dass du mir da weiter hilfst.
Hier mal meine /etc/liveice.cfg:
SERVER 127.0.0.1
PORT 8000
PASSWORD klartext
SHOUT_MODE
NO_SOUNDCARD
PLAYLIST /root/playlist.txt
USE_LAME3
Rufe ich liveice auf, erscheint folgendes:
debian:/etc# liveice
playlist
/root/playlist.txt
4
opening connection to 127.0.0.1 8000
Attempting to Contact Server
connection successful: forking process
Folgendes erscheint in der icecast.log:
[13/Sep/2004:16:17:33] [0:Main Thread] Icecast Version 1.3.11-debian Starting..
[13/Sep/2004:16:17:33] [0:Main Thread] Trying to fork
[13/Sep/2004:16:17:33] [0:Main Thread] Detached (pid: 5376)
[13/Sep/2004:16:17:33] [0:Main Thread] Starting main connection handler...
[13/Sep/2004:16:17:33] [0:Main Thread] Listening on port 8000...
[13/Sep/2004:16:17:33] [0:Main Thread] Using 'debian' as servername...
[13/Sep/2004:16:17:33] [0:Main Thread] Server limits: 10 clients, 800 clients per source, 5 sources, 5 admins
[13/Sep/2004:16:17:33] [0:Main Thread] WWW Admin interface accessible at http://debian:8000/admin
[13/Sep/2004:16:17:33] [0:Main Thread] Starting Calender Thread...
[13/Sep/2004:16:17:33] [0:Main Thread] Starting UDP handler thread...
[13/Sep/2004:16:17:33] [0:Main Thread] Starting relay connector thread...
[13/Sep/2004:16:17:56] [4:Connection Handler] Accepted encoder on mountpoint /live from localhost. 1 sources connected
[13/Sep/2004:16:18:23] [4:Source Thread] Lost connection to source on mount /live, waiting 30 seconds for timeout
[13/Sep/2004:16:18:53] [4:Source Thread] Kicking source 0 [localhost] [Client timeout exceeded, removing source] [encoder], connected for 57 seconds, 0 bytes transfered. 0 sources connected
[13/Sep/2004:16:18:53] [4:Source Thread] Kicking all 0 clients for source 0
Als ich mit winamp versuchte den Stream zu hören, bekam ich nach ein paar Sekunden einen Timeout.
Für Hilfe wäre ich sehr dankbar.
Ich glaube ja, dass meine liveice.cfg nicht passt.
Gruß
Simon
freut mich, dass du mir da weiter hilfst.
Hier mal meine /etc/liveice.cfg:
SERVER 127.0.0.1
PORT 8000
PASSWORD klartext
SHOUT_MODE
NO_SOUNDCARD
PLAYLIST /root/playlist.txt
USE_LAME3
Rufe ich liveice auf, erscheint folgendes:
debian:/etc# liveice
playlist
/root/playlist.txt
4
opening connection to 127.0.0.1 8000
Attempting to Contact Server
connection successful: forking process
Folgendes erscheint in der icecast.log:
[13/Sep/2004:16:17:33] [0:Main Thread] Icecast Version 1.3.11-debian Starting..
[13/Sep/2004:16:17:33] [0:Main Thread] Trying to fork
[13/Sep/2004:16:17:33] [0:Main Thread] Detached (pid: 5376)
[13/Sep/2004:16:17:33] [0:Main Thread] Starting main connection handler...
[13/Sep/2004:16:17:33] [0:Main Thread] Listening on port 8000...
[13/Sep/2004:16:17:33] [0:Main Thread] Using 'debian' as servername...
[13/Sep/2004:16:17:33] [0:Main Thread] Server limits: 10 clients, 800 clients per source, 5 sources, 5 admins
[13/Sep/2004:16:17:33] [0:Main Thread] WWW Admin interface accessible at http://debian:8000/admin
[13/Sep/2004:16:17:33] [0:Main Thread] Starting Calender Thread...
[13/Sep/2004:16:17:33] [0:Main Thread] Starting UDP handler thread...
[13/Sep/2004:16:17:33] [0:Main Thread] Starting relay connector thread...
[13/Sep/2004:16:17:56] [4:Connection Handler] Accepted encoder on mountpoint /live from localhost. 1 sources connected
[13/Sep/2004:16:18:23] [4:Source Thread] Lost connection to source on mount /live, waiting 30 seconds for timeout
[13/Sep/2004:16:18:53] [4:Source Thread] Kicking source 0 [localhost] [Client timeout exceeded, removing source] [encoder], connected for 57 seconds, 0 bytes transfered. 0 sources connected
[13/Sep/2004:16:18:53] [4:Source Thread] Kicking all 0 clients for source 0
Als ich mit winamp versuchte den Stream zu hören, bekam ich nach ein paar Sekunden einen Timeout.
Für Hilfe wäre ich sehr dankbar.
Ich glaube ja, dass meine liveice.cfg nicht passt.
Gruß
Simon
- mragucci
- Beiträge: 598
- Registriert: 08.09.2004 03:21:24
- Lizenz eigener Beiträge: MIT Lizenz
- Wohnort: Endor
-
Kontaktdaten:
Re: icecast und icelive
Hmmm,
also, ich bin nicht der Experte für Icecast, aber schaun mer mal....
PLAYLIST /root/playlist.txt
Die Datei /root/playlist.txt existiert und beinhaltet die MP3's, die abgespielt werden sollen (inklusive Pfadangabe, wenn Sie nicht in /root liegen)?
Die Files sind lesbar?
BTW: Warum /root? Das impliziert, dass du liveice als root laufen lassen willst... Nicht gut!
USE_LAME3
LAME3 Encoder ist installiert???
Füg deiner liveice.cfg (BTW: Hast du Debian? Bei mir haut er das in die /etc/icecast/liveice.cfg rein, nicht, dass dein Config-File am falschen Ort liegt...)
VERBOSE 10
Bis denne,
Mario
also, ich bin nicht der Experte für Icecast, aber schaun mer mal....
PLAYLIST /root/playlist.txt
Die Datei /root/playlist.txt existiert und beinhaltet die MP3's, die abgespielt werden sollen (inklusive Pfadangabe, wenn Sie nicht in /root liegen)?
Die Files sind lesbar?
BTW: Warum /root? Das impliziert, dass du liveice als root laufen lassen willst... Nicht gut!
USE_LAME3
LAME3 Encoder ist installiert???
Füg deiner liveice.cfg (BTW: Hast du Debian? Bei mir haut er das in die /etc/icecast/liveice.cfg rein, nicht, dass dein Config-File am falschen Ort liegt...)
VERBOSE 10
Bis denne,
Mario
Ich will im Schlaf sterben - Wie mein Opa...
Und nicht weinend und schreiend wie sein Beifahrer!
-----
https://www.whisperedshouts.de
Und nicht weinend und schreiend wie sein Beifahrer!
-----
https://www.whisperedshouts.de
Re: icecast und icelive
Hallo,
liveice funktioniert! Folgende Probleme habe ich behoben:
1. Ich hatte den Lame encoder aus dem Quellcode installiert. Die Binärdatei hatte aber den Namen lame und nicht lame3.
Als ich die Datei umbenannte hats geklappt.
2. In der Playlist dürfen offenbar nur .mp3-Dateien und keine .wav-Dateien stehen.
Danke für deine Hilfe.
Etwas gefällt mir an liveice aber nicht:
Editiere ich die playlist im laufenden Betrieb, werden die Änderungen nicht übernommen.
Gibt es ein Programm ohne grafische Oberfläche, dass so etwas kann?
Man soll die Playlist erweitern können und die hinzugefügten Titel sollen auch mit abgespielt werden.
Gruß
Simon
liveice funktioniert! Folgende Probleme habe ich behoben:
1. Ich hatte den Lame encoder aus dem Quellcode installiert. Die Binärdatei hatte aber den Namen lame und nicht lame3.
Als ich die Datei umbenannte hats geklappt.
2. In der Playlist dürfen offenbar nur .mp3-Dateien und keine .wav-Dateien stehen.
Danke für deine Hilfe.
Etwas gefällt mir an liveice aber nicht:
Editiere ich die playlist im laufenden Betrieb, werden die Änderungen nicht übernommen.
Gibt es ein Programm ohne grafische Oberfläche, dass so etwas kann?
Man soll die Playlist erweitern können und die hinzugefügten Titel sollen auch mit abgespielt werden.
Gruß
Simon